Renaming Rules Disappear

I have a persistent issue with my renaming rules. About once a year they disappear from my file. Sounds odd but they also disappear from any backup that have been created (backups where I know the renaming rules still existed at the time of backup). It's getting a little old, the rules disappear, I rebuild them again over a few months, then they disappear again a few months later. At the suggestion of Quicken Tech Support I rebuilt my file from scratch several years ago. I've checked the most recent file for errors. Nothing keeps this from happening.

Does anyone have any ideas? Does anyone know where the renaming rules are kept? Since they also disappear from my backup files they must be in a different file than the data.

    No solution or suggestions, just some clarification.
    The Renaming Rules are Quicken data file specific and are retained in each data file.  The QDF data file itself is a variation of a zipped file with multiple files in it.  It can be taken apart using zip software, but you can NOT put it back together using zip software.

    I recommend you turn off Sync since you're not using the web or mobile apps. Go to Edit / Preferences / Mobile & Web to do so.
    This eliminates one possible source of data corruption. And you can't use a Sync file to restore a lost data file from.
    Do make sure that you are sending the backup files created as you close Quicken to Dropbox. Do not allow Dropbox (or any other cloud backup program) to directly access the active Quicken data file!
